COMMERCIAL

LONDON MARKETS. SHEKPSKLNS. Daigety and Company Limited, Wellington, have received the following cable from their Loudon House dated 30th instant reading as followsI'rices at the Sheepskin Sales are firm at the parity of closing rates of last London Sales." PAIHATUA STOCK SALE. Abraham and Williams, Ltd., report- as follows:—We offered a.good yarding of both sheep and cattle. All the sheep changed hands at good values, and a large clearance was made in cattle, good dairy sorts attain selling exceptionally well.
